Climate is a major driver of forest species distributions and the growth rate and structure of forests. Thus, climate change can potentially have significant effects on mountain forest hydrology, particularly the amount of water available downstream. However, many other factors influence forest biomass and mountain hydrology, and climate change effects cannot be viewed in isolation from previous land use histories (i.e. forest legacies), altered disturbance regimes (e.g. fire frequency, insect outbreaks, floods) and invasive species.

Lake Oussudu, which is the largest wetland in the Union Territory of Pondicherry, is one of the most important bird sanctuaries in India. Apart from being an important water resource and a heritage site, Oussudu watershed also caters to the other needs of the people living around the lake; notably fishing, grazing of the domestic livestock and harvesting of reeds.

A lot of wash load comes to the streams during the rainy season due to the erosion of soil from the catchment and known to flow practically without settling on the streambed. The presence of wash load is known to affect the resistance to the flow. The effect of its presence on transport of bed material load is not well known. The present paper is devoted to a review of the studies regarding concept of wash load, changes in resistance to flow due to the presence of wash load, the effect of presence of fines in suspension on the transport of bed-material.

Climate models and satellite observations both indicate that the total amount of water in the atmosphere will increase at a rate of 7% per kelvin of surface warming. However, the climate models predict that global precipitation will increase at a much slower rate of 1 to 3% per kelvin. A recent analysis of satellite observations does not support this prediction of a muted response of precipitation to global warming. Rather, the observations suggest that precipitation and total atmospheric water have increased at about the same rate over the past two decades.
